It's not clear how much of an effect protein has on metabolism, but studies suggest the … Web16 de jul. de 2024 · The protein/carbohydrate/fat ratio is one of the best ways to predict if a food has a higher-thermic effect. Protein's thermic effect is between 20-30% of the calories consumed. Carbs have a thermic effect between 5-10%, and fat has the lowest thermic effect between 0-3%.
